#2c93c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c93c8 is composed of 17.3% red, 57.6%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78% cyan, 26.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 200.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 47.8%. #2c93c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ffff with #002791.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#2c93c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c93c8 has RGB values of R:44, G:147,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 2921416.

Shades and Tints of #2c93c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020507 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c93c8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777b7d is the less saturated color, while #069fee is the most saturated one.
